An-124 Condor vs An-225 Cossack
Overview
The An-124 Condor and the An-225 Cossack are both Military Transport Aircraft, manufactured by Antonov and Antonov respectively.
Top speed is 865 km/h for the An-124 Condor vs 850 km/h for the An-225 Cossack. The An-124 Condor has an operational range of 3,700 km vs 15,400 km for the An-225 Cossack. The An-225 Cossack operates at altitudes up to 12,000 m compared to 9,000 m for the An-124 Condor.
The An-124 Condor has been produced in 55 units vs 1 for the An-225 Cossack. Unit cost is $100M for the An-124 Condor vs $250M for the An-225 Cossack. The An-124 Condor first flew 6 years before the An-225 Cossack (1982 vs 1988).
